Union County sets school record in romp over Oglethorpe

By Jeff Hart Sports Reporter

LEXINGTON — Union County set a new-school record for consecutive wins Friday night with a 56-0 whitewash of Oglethorpe County in Region 8-2A action.

The victory for the Panthers (8-0, 4-0 Region 8-2A), their 10th straight, also clinched a showdown with arch-rival Rabun County (8-0, 4-0) on Nov. 2 for the region title. The old mark of nine straight wins had been set from Aug. 31 to Nov. 9, 2001.

“We’re very excited about the streak,” said coach Brian Allison, who was the coach of the Panthers in 2001 in his first stint in Blairsville. “This group may not be the most talented we’ve ever had but they work hard and play hard together. It’s a fun group to be around.”

Junior quarterback Pierson Allison tossed three touchdown passes, two to Chayton Shafer and one to Kyle Morlock. Chad Buzzard and Jonah Daniel each had a pair of touchdown runs. Kanon Hemphill also returned the opening kickoff of the second half 90 yards for a touchdown.

Union County will play host to Social Circle next week before its season finale against the No. 3-ranked Wildcats.

“We still have a lot of things to work on,” Allison said. “We’re playing okay but I think we can still get a lot better.”
